South Korean President Lee host Japanese Premier Ishiba
Shigeru Ishiba is on two-day trip to South Korea
By Berk Kutay Gokmen
ISTANBUL (AA) - South Korean President Lee Jae Myung on Tuesday hosted Japanese Prime Minister Shigeru Ishibain the southeastern city of Busan, Yonhap news reported.
Ishiba arrived in South Korea for a two-day trip following Lee's visit to Japan last month. It is his first trip to the country since taking office last October.
Before the visit, South Korean National Security Adviser Wi Sung-lac said the agenda of the meeting will include demographic changes and regional revitalization, along with future-oriented cooperation in areas such as AI and hydrogen energy.
The two leaders are also expected to discuss trade related issues as Japan this month signed a trade deal with the US, while South Korea is negotiating details of its own framework agreement reached in July.
Ishiba announced his resignation earlier this month, and the ruling Liberal Democratic Party will elect a new leader on Oct. 4 to replace him.
Ishiba stepped down after his ruling coalition lost its majority in both houses of parliament amid voter anger over the rising cost of living.
